“That was the weirdest thing ever,” Jeff muttered to himself as he kept up
his walk down the promenade.  It wasn’t long until he came across another
unfamiliar store that looked like it was taking up a lot of space and
curious as to what it was he tucked his head into the store and looked
around.  Almost immediately a man with a smile came up to him and asked how
he could be of service.

 

“What’s this store sell?” Jeff asked, looking around and noticing that it
appeared to be a showroom of sorts; full of small personal shuttle craft
that for the most part looked like they had seen better days.

 

“Only top quality stuff sir, I assure you,” the man said, his words seeming
to completely contradict the state of some of the shuttles in the room.
Quite quickly and adroitly he put a hand on Jeff’s arm and led the taller
man across the room to the few shuttles that were on display.  “As you can
see by these prime specimens of personal use shuttle craft our little
outpost here only specializes in the best of the best.”

 

“They all look used,” Jeff commented, afraid to touch the one he was near
for fear that any slight movement might cause part of it to fall off.

 

“They are used!” the salesman beamed at him.  “And that’s how I’m able to
pass along some ridiculous savings to you!”

 

“Excuse me?” Jeff asked, completely bewildered.

 

“Take this great shuttle for example,” the man continued, leaning on the
shuttle closest to the two of them casually.  “Normally it would cost you a
pretty penny but you can buy it used from us for less than half the price it
would cost you to buy it from one of the new shuttle retailers.”

 

“I see,” Jeff answered.

 

“Do you really?” the man asked, straightening up and surreptitiously kicking
a piece of the frame that had fallen off underneath the shuttle in the
process.  “When you buy from those guys, all you’re doing is paying for the
frills.  You’re not getting quality for your money!  I’m here selling you
the *exact* same shuttle for less than *one half* of the price!  How can you
*not* take advantage of this deal?!”

 

“I…err…don’t need a shuttle?” Jeff half said, half asked.

 

The man’s expression changed slightly.  “Then why are you in here?” he
asked.

 

“I…” Jeff felt quite sheepish.  “I was just curious as to what was being
sold in here.  I never really planned to buy anything.”

 

“I see…” the man’s demeanor changed completely now that he was made aware
that he would not be able to get a sale.  “Well, if you need anymore help,
feel free to ask.” With that he pushed past the doctor and went to accost
another man that had just entered the store.

 

Jeff was a little taken aback by the sudden departure of the salesman, but
couldn’t help but shake his head and chuckle, especially when his eyes fell
on the frame piece that hadn’t quite made it all the way underneath the
shuttle body.  Dealers of used transportation equipment were the same the
universe over it seemed.  

 

He spent a few more minutes browsing around the woefully low quality
selection of shuttles available before shaking his head again as he left.
On his way out the door he caught notice of the store’s name (Tex’s Shuttle
Emporium) as well as the nametag the salesman was wearing, extravagantly
stating that his name was Tex Martman.
